Grounding Spot Launches Florida's First Mobile Meditation & IV Therapy Unit
eTradeWire News/10826624
FORT MYERS, Fla. - eTradeWire -- A new concept in mental wellness is making its debut in Southwest Florida that founders say is Florida's first mobile meditation and IV therapy unit.
Dubbed "Food Truck for the Soul," the wellness bus was created by Frances Borshell as an extension of Grounding Spot, which Borshell founded last year at Coconut Point Mall in Estero. This new mobile experience brings meditation, IV vitamin therapy, and aesthetic services directly to the community.
At the heart of this innovation is a custom-converted 27-foot bus featuring seven private meditation pods, including one that is handicapped accessible. Each pod is designed with a comfortable seat, cushions, a table computer, and noise-canceling headphones to offer visitors an immersive and restorative meditation session lasting up to 15 minutes.
"Our mission at Grounding Spot is to make mental fitness as mainstream as physical fitness," said Borshell. "This mobile unit is about accessibility. We're bringing meditation and rejuvenating therapies directly to the community. Whether at businesses, hospitals, schools or events—anyone can experience the benefits of stillness, restoration, and self-care."
A Mobile Oasis of Calm
Step inside the bus, and a feeling of calm takes over instantly, she said.

"The interior is softly lit and intentionally designed to help guests disconnect from the outside world. In each private pod, visitors can choose from guided meditations, binaural beats, or silent meditation, all in convenient 15-minute sessions. Privacy curtains, customizable lighting, and comfortable seating allow for total relaxation on the spot," she said.
In addition to meditation, the bus offers IV Vitamin Therapy, designed to boost hydration, immunity, and energy, as well as Stem Cell and Exosome Therapy to promote healing, hair growth, and skin rejuvenation.
"We are very excited about Exosome Therapy because it uses the regenerative power of stem cells without using the stem cells themselves to reduce fine lines and wrinkles, activate dormant hair follicles, and help calm inflammation which is beneficial for conditions like osteoarthritis," Borshell said.
Available for Appointments
The Grounding Spot mobile unit makes appearances at community events, schools, corporate campuses, wellness festivals, and healthcare facilities throughout Florida. Organizations will be able to contract the bus for employee wellness programs, giving staff the opportunity to enjoy regular meditation and therapy sessions without leaving the workplace.
